Introduction | ***When these blogs were started we lived in St. George Utah. We Currently reside in Tooele, Ut. We are Church planters of Lakeview Church. Stansbury Park and Grantsville. Phil & I married in 2005, Lived in Eagle Mountain until 2007. Moved to Sandy & lived there until fall of 2008, when we moved to St George. We lived in St George until 2014 ( we had 3 of our 4 children there) 2014-2018 found us in Millcreek, Utah. We have been involved in Church ministry of some sort this entire time. My last post was when we were leaving St. G. I recently felt drawn to re-read some of my thoughts, especially the ones about dealing with the loss of our son. Who knows if I'll write more.
